About 1 Hammer Lane
1 Hammer Lane is a five-bedroom detached house in Haslemere (GU27 3QS). It has a recorded floor area of 195 m² (around 2099 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(March 2025) shows a C (score 74). When first surveyed in May 2019 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Average to Good and lighting went from Poor to Very Good.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 82).
At 195 m² the property is well over the postcode median (102 m² across 12 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 83% of similar EPCs). 5 bedrooms is on the larger side for this postcode, where 4 is the typical count. Today's modelled estimate of £930,000 sits 97.9% above the 2020 sale of £470,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£224/sq ft) was about 18% below the postcode norm. One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2020.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Last sale on file: £470,000 in March 2020.
